The FM 181 Bridge access point provides convenient public launch access to the Blanco River near Wimberley in Hays County. Located just east of Trinity (approximately 3 miles via Texas Highway 94), the boat ramp is situated on the right side of the bridge, making it easy to locate. This site serves as a practical put-in for kayakers, canoeists, and motorboaters looking to explore this section of the Blanco River.
Paddlers using this access can expect scenic bluff views and good fishing opportunities in the deeper waters downstream. For those interested in longer paddling trips, an alternative route begins at Slime Bridge, where vehicle parking is available at John Knox Ranch—from there, paddlers can navigate upstream approximately 1 mile before returning to the FM 179 crossing for take-out. This flexibility makes the FM 181 area part of a larger network of access points suitable for half-day or full-day outings on the Blanco River.
